Central Nervous System (CNS)

- Brain (processes information)

- Spinal cord (conducts information thru body)

2
New cards

Peripheral Nervous System (PNS)

the sensory and motor neurons that connect the central nervous system (CNS) to the rest of the body.

Think: eyes being the medium in which your brain can process the information

3
New cards

AUTOnomic

Involuntary movements

Ex: think of how the heart muscle pumps blood without prompting

4
New cards

Somatic

Voluntary movement

Ex: How your bones move in your body

5
New cards

enteric nervous system

The nervous system of the gastrointestinal tract. It controls secretion and motility within the Gi tract.

6
New cards

sympathetic nervous system

the division of the autonomic nervous system that arouses the body, mobilizing its energy in stressful situations

"Fight or flight"

7
New cards

Parasympathetic

the division of the autonomic nervous system that calms the body, conserving1 its energy

"Rest and digest"

8
New cards

Signs of sympathetic stimulation include

- increased HR

- bronchodilation (making it easier to breathe by relaxing the lung muscles)

- Dilated pupils

- inhibits digestion

- glucose released

- inhibits peristalsis

- Adrenalin production

- relaxed bladder

Think: your body is making it easy to get away in a hurry if needed.

9
New cards

Sings of Parasympathetic stimulation include

- constriction of pupils

- decreased HR

- bronchoconstriction

- simulates stomach digestion

- bile releases

- stimulates peristalsis

- constricts bladder

11
New cards

adrenergic a1 receptors

Constrict the vasculature, smooth muscle, and heart.

(Vasoconstriction)

12
New cards

Adrenergic a2 receptors

Sedate, help with pain relief, vasodilator, inhibit insulin

Within the CNS and pancreas

13
New cards

Adrenergic B1 receptors

Increases heart rate and contractility within the cardiac muscle, sinus note, and AV junction.

Aka: force your heart to pump harder and faster.

THINK: heart

14
New cards

Adrenergic B2 receptors

Vasodilator, bronchodilator, hepatic glycogenolysis within the muscles, liver, skeletal vascular, and cell membranes

THINK: LUNGS

15
New cards

Dopamine receptors

Vasodilation / (at higher doses) vasoconstriction.

Within kidneys, heart, organs, and cerebral vasxulature

16
New cards

Vasopressin receptors

Vasoconstriction within the vascular smooth muscle

17
New cards

Positive inotrope

Increase cardiac output by making heart squeeze harder

18
New cards

When to use a positive inotrope medication

- cardiogenic shock

- CHF,

- Post MI

19
New cards

Examples of positive inotrope meds

- Digoxin

- Epinephrine

- Milrinone
